One of the things I really wanted to see on our Garden Route trip were the African Penguins. The best place to see them is at Boulders Beach, about a 45-min drive south of Cape Town, and it is really a wonderful place to see penguins. You can walk along a boardwalk and get quite close to them. I have seen penguins in the Galapagos and in Australia, but this is the best place to get close and take photos.
The African Penguin, also known as the Black-footed Penguin is a species of penguin, confined to southern African waters. It is also widely known as the "Jackass" Penguin for its donkey-like bray, although several species of South American penguins produce the same sound.
